The South Seneca High School Student Government will hold its Sixth Annual After-Prom Event to promote Prom Night Safety. The prom will be held on May 21, 2022, and the After-Prom Event will be held immediately after Prom ends. The event will be from 11:30 PM until 4:00 AM at the South Seneca High School Gymnasium. Throughout the event, there will be games, bounce houses, a movie, food, and an abundance of prizes.

Congratulations to 2018 South Seneca graduate Cameron Cupp. His Honors Thesis project, titled ""Franco's Failed War of Legitimacy: Constructing Historical Memory of the Spanish Civil War in Education"" was given the prestigious 2021-22 Presidential Award for Undergraduate Research at the University of Albany.
This project is a culmination of over a year of research and development as an honors student within the university's History Department. He will be graduating from the University of Albany next month with a dual Bachelor's Degree in Political Science and History, and plans to attend law school next fall.
